BlackRock MuniYield New York Quality Fund, Inc. (NYSE:MYN – Get Free Report) saw a large drop in short interest in the month of January. As of January 15th, there was short interest totalling 79,500 shares, a drop of 19.2% from the December 31st total of 98,400 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 104,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 0.8 days.

BlackRock MuniYield New York Quality Fund Company Profile
BlackRock MuniYield New York Quality Fund, Inc is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ched by BlackRock, Inc It is managed by BlackRock Advisors, LLC. The fund invests in fixed income markets. It invests primarily in a portfolio of long-term investment grade municipal bonds exempt from federal income taxes and New York State and New York City personal income taxes.
